| KidCare The Beyond the Bell Branch (BTB) KidCare is a state sponsored program that provides an environment where children can participate in intellectual, creative, social and recreational activities that are developmentally and linguistically appropriate and culturally relevant. KidCare activities support and enhance elementary school programs and are designed to meet the individual needs of each child. KidCare staff work in cooperation with parents, other school staff and the community to achieve program goals and objectives. KidCare activities include homework time, multicultural activities, snacks, arts and crafts, games and other recreation. The goals of the KidCare program are as follows: • To provide a safe environment for children. • To provide activities for children that are developmentally and linguistically appropriate and which will supplement the elementary school program. • To ensure that subsidized and non-subsidized children receive equivalent services. • To serve children in a nondiscriminatory manner in regard to race, ethnicity, sex, religion and children’s special needs. • To use community and District resources including educational, cultural and recreational activities in order to promote a diversified program for children and to achieve cost effectiveness. • To provide creative opportunities for staff to continue professional growth and to foster positive communication. HOURS OF OPERATION SCHOOL DAYS The program operates from the close of the regular school day until 6:00 p.m. Operating hours are extended on minimum and shortened days to accommodate early dismissals. VACATION DAYS The program may be open from 7:00 a.m. until 6:00 p.m. during school vacation periods, subject to District discretion. The program is not open on Saturdays, Sundays, and District Designated holidays. FACILITIES The program uses a classroom or other on-site school facility. Most programs can accommodate approximately 28 children. Transportation is not provided. STAFF/CHILD RATIO To ensure the safety and well being of participating students a 14 to 1 ratio is maintain. PARENTS RESPONSIBILITIES ENROLLMENT A Subsidized family must complete an application and provide supporting documentation demonstrating eligibility and need for services. Family fees are based on a sliding fee scale. A Full cost family must complete an application for services-there are no pre-requisites for enrollment. Full Cost families pay a flat full cost fee rate. NUTRITION A nutritious snack including milk or juice is served to the children enrolled in the program. Breakfast, lunch and an afternoon snack is provided to all children enrolled in the KidCare program during intersession. |
